-Always spray in a well-ventilated area. -When spraying, hold the can 12-18 inches from the surface and spray in a steady back-and-forth motion. -Two or three light coats are usually better than one heavy coat. -Allow the paint to dry completely before using the cinder blocks.

Cinder blocks can be spray painted with a variety of colors to brighten up any space. To spray paint cinder blocks, start by cleaning the surface of the blocks with a wire brush to remove any dirt or debris. Next, apply a coat of primer to the blocks and let them dry. Once the primer is dry, apply a coat of paint in your desired color and let it dry.
